  • How is the weather in Myrtle Beach?

    Myrtle Beach has mild winters around 39–61°F (4–16°C), with warm, humid summers reaching 88°F (31°C) at the peak. Showers are common in summer, so lightweight rain gear is helpful for outdoor plans.

  • What are some hiking trails in Myrtle Beach?

    Stroll the nature trails at Myrtle Beach State Park or Huntington Beach State Park, where paths wind through maritime forests, salt marshes, and coastal habitats. These parks are known for accessible walks and opportunities for wildlife observation.

  • What are some of the best day trip ideas from Myrtle Beach?

    Consider exploring the historic streets and waterfront of Georgetown, visiting Brookgreen Gardens for sculpture and botanical displays, or discovering the atmosphere of Murrells Inlet, known for its marshwalk and local seafood.

  • What is Myrtle Beach known for?

    Myrtle Beach is known for its long sandy shoreline, vibrant boardwalk, and entertainment complexes. The area has roots in live music, golf culture, and family-friendly attractions.

  • What are the best foods to try in Myrtle Beach?

    Sample Lowcountry seafood such as shrimp and grits, she-crab soup, and fried flounder, often highlighted on local menus. Barbecue, hush puppies, and classic beachside ice cream are also local favorites.
